About A. W. V. Poole
A. W. V. Poole is a scholar working on Astronomy and Astrophysics, Geophysics and Oceanography, having authored 23 papers that have together received 830 indexed citations. Recurring topics across this work include Ionosphere and magnetosphere dynamics (20 papers), Earthquake Detection and Analysis (12 papers) and Solar and Space Plasma Dynamics (7 papers). The work is most often cited by research in Astronomy and Astrophysics (753 citations), Geophysics (509 citations) and Aerospace Engineering (357 citations). A. W. V. Poole has collaborated with scholars based in South Africa, United Kingdom and Australia. Frequent co-authors include Lee‐Anne McKinnell, P. Sutcliffe, E.O. Oyeyemi, A. D. M. Walker, G. P. Evans, Michael Poole, Phil Wilkinson, S. A. Bell, R. Stamper and C. J. Davis. Their work appears in journals such as Journal of Geophysical Research Atmospheres, Geophysical Research Letters and Planetary and Space Science.
